A small wet market, mostly with Chinese vendors but where you can definitely find the freshest of seasonal vegetables and fruits as well as some good chicken and pork and dry seasonings such as dry shrimps, anchovies, salted fish and all the usual Chinese herbs and ingredients required for some of the delicious Chinese herbal dishes and soups. Most vendors might seem a bit rugged at first but once they know you for being a regular customer they will always provide you with excellent service and give you a few extras. The market is atrached to the seventeen mall and residences which provides a very cheap and convenient parking even though old habits unfortunately die hard here and most people still prefer to park 2nd lane or even 3rd lane annoying all other road users and blocking traffic rather than paying the RM1 parking fee.
